Jalal Malik-Ikram, a retired cop who spent the past four months working in the Wayne County Juvenile Detention Facility, said some of what he has seen gave him nightmares.
Sexual assaults, fights and poor supervision are rampant at Wayne County's troubled Juvenile Detention Facility, according to multiple former employees who paint a portrait of a facility in chaos.
